Project

General

Profile

Emulator Issues #12308

Android: Emulated IR pointer doesn't reach edges of screen

Added by ryanebola16 about 1 year ago. Updated about 1 year ago.

Status:
Fixed
Priority:
Normal
Assignee:
% Done:

0%

Operating system:
Android
Issue type:
Bug
Milestone:
Regression:
No
Relates to usability:
No
Relates to performance:
No
Easy:
No
Relates to maintainability:
No
Regression start:
Fixed in:
5.0-12970

Description

What steps will reproduce the problem?

Try to move the IR pointer to the edge of the screen

Is the issue present in the latest development version? For future reference, please also write down the version number of the latest development version.

5.0-12941

What are your PC specifications? (CPU, GPU, Operating System, more)

Samsung Galaxy Note8 (SM-N950U)
Qualcomm Snapdragon 835
Octa-core (4x2.35 GHz Kryo & 4x1.9 GHz Kryo)
Adreno 540
6GB RAM (LPDDR4)
Android 9
OpenGL ES 3.2 V@331.0

Is there anything else that can help developers narrow down the issue? (e.g. logs, screenshots,
configuration files, savefiles, savestates)

https://github.com/dolphin-emu/dolphin/pull/9106 may be able to help with this problem.

History

#1 Updated by JosJuice about 1 year ago

Did you adjust the total pitch and total yaw?

#2 Updated by ryanebola16 about 1 year ago

I'm using default values (reset via the new "default values" button). Does this problem not occur on your phone with default values for IR sensitivity settings?

#3 Updated by JosJuice about 1 year ago

I do have the problem with the default values. (I tested the home menu in Xenoblade Chronicles.) It's impossible to have a set of defaults that's reasonable for every game (if you try to get the whole screen to be reachable in e.g. Skyward Sword then the cursor is way too fast in most games), but it seems like the Android defaults are lower than the normal defaults, so maybe we should change the Android defaults to match?

#4 Updated by ryanebola16 about 1 year ago

I haven't looked into a solution for this issue yet since I was waiting to see if https://github.com/dolphin-emu/dolphin/pull/9208 is acceptable. If the default values for Android don't match normal defaults, it's worth trying normal defaults. Wii Sports is the game I use for IR pointer testing.

#6 Updated by ryanebola16 about 1 year ago

Oh yeah, those values work nicely for me. I'll test them with a few more games and if it is an improvement for most of them, I'll submit a PR.

#7 Updated by ryanebola16 about 1 year ago

  • Assignee set to ryanebola16
  • Status changed from New to Fix pending

#8 Updated by JosJuice about 1 year ago

  • Fixed in set to 5.0-12970
  • Status changed from Fix pending to Fixed

Also available in: Atom PDF